Whether you’re downsizing or sharing a small house with multiple people, making the most of a tight living space takes careful planning. Finding furniture for petite homes or apartments can be challenging, as large pieces can take up a lot of usable space. To help you make the most of your living areas, follow the tips in this guide.

How to Make a Small Home Roomier With the Right Furniture

1. Pick Small Items

To maximize your living space, choose smaller pieces of furniture. For example, two recliners in the living room will take up less space than a sectional sofa. To create the visual effect of larger areas, opt for pieces that are slim and modern. Selecting neutral tones will also help the furniture blend seamlessly with the room.

2. Choose Options With Function

furnitureA common issue in small living spaces is finding places to store your belongings. When shopping for furniture, look for pieces that double as storage compartments. Some couches include roll-out drawers beneath them that can be used for blankets and pillows. A coffee table with a shelf underneath can hold books and other trinkets. Making your furniture fulfill two purposes is an excellent way to maximize space.

3. Limit the Number of Pieces

It may be tempting to mix and match small pieces of furniture in a tight room to grant yourself the flexibility of moving them around. However, putting too many items into a small space can make it feel disorganized and cramped. Instead, get a few staple pieces that fit into the room without overwhelming it.
